As a Pe Foam supplier, I&#8217;ve witnessed firsthand the diverse and innovative ways this material is utilized in creating foam thermo &#8211; formed packaging across various industries. <a href=\"https:\/\/www.firefoxfoam.com\/pe-foam\/\">Pe Foam<\/a><\/p>\n<p><img decoding=\"async\" src=\"https:\/\/www.firefoxfoam.com\/uploads\/46967\/small\/6mm-eva-foam-sheets20260514113507dded1.jpg\"><\/p>\n<h3>The Basics of Pe Foam<\/h3>\n<p>Before delving into its applications, it&#8217;s essential to understand what makes Pe Foam an ideal choice for thermo &#8211; formed packaging. Pe Foam is a closed &#8211; cell foam made from polyethylene resin. It offers a range of desirable properties, including excellent cushioning, light &#8211; weight, water resistance, chemical resistance, and thermal insulation. These properties make it an invaluable asset in the packaging industry, especially when it comes to creating protective and functional thermo &#8211; formed packaging solutions.<\/p>\n<h3>Electronics Packaging<\/h3>\n<p>One of the most prominent applications of Pe Foam in thermo &#8211; formed packaging is in the electronics industry. Electronic devices are often delicate and susceptible to damage from impacts, vibrations, and static electricity. Pe Foam provides an effective solution to these problems.<\/p>\n<p>In the manufacturing of smartphones, tablets, and laptops, thermo &#8211; formed Pe Foam inserts are used to securely hold the devices in place within their packaging. The foam&#8217;s cushioning properties absorb shocks during transportation and handling, preventing scratches, cracks, and internal component damage. Additionally, anti &#8211; static grades of Pe Foam can be incorporated to protect sensitive electronic circuits from electrostatic discharge (ESD).<\/p>\n<p>Pe Foam&#8217;s lightweight nature is also a significant advantage for electronics packaging. It helps reduce shipping costs by minimizing the overall weight of the packaged product. For example, a high &#8211; end camera might be packaged in a thermo &#8211; formed Pe Foam tray that not only protects the device but also keeps the shipping weight down, making it more cost &#8211; effective to transport globally.<\/p>\n<h3>Food Packaging<\/h3>\n<p>Food safety and preservation are of utmost importance in the food industry. Pe Foam is well &#8211; suited for thermo &#8211; formed food packaging due to its hygienic properties, water resistance, and thermal insulation capabilities.<\/p>\n<p>In the packaging of fresh produce, such as fruits and vegetables, thermo &#8211; formed Pe Foam trays can help extend the shelf life of the products. The foam&#8217;s closed &#8211; cell structure prevents moisture from seeping in, reducing the risk of spoilage. It also provides a cushion to protect the produce from bruising during handling and transportation.<\/p>\n<p>For frozen foods, Pe Foam&#8217;s thermal insulation properties are crucial. Thermo &#8211; formed Pe Foam containers can maintain a low temperature, keeping the food frozen for longer periods. This is particularly important for products that are shipped over long distances or stored in less &#8211; than &#8211; optimal refrigeration conditions. Moreover, Pe Foam can be made food &#8211; grade compliant, ensuring that it meets the strict safety standards required for direct contact with food.<\/p>\n<h3>Medical Packaging<\/h3>\n<p>The medical industry demands the highest level of quality and protection for its products. Pe Foam has found extensive use in thermo &#8211; formed medical packaging for a variety of reasons.<\/p>\n<p>Medical devices, such as syringes, catheters, and surgical instruments, need to be protected from damage and contamination. Thermo &#8211; formed Pe Foam trays can be custom &#8211; designed to fit the specific shape and size of these devices. The foam&#8217;s cushioning properties prevent breakage, while its closed &#8211; cell structure acts as a barrier against dust, moisture, and microorganisms.<\/p>\n<p>In the case of pharmaceutical products, Pe Foam can be used to create thermo &#8211; formed blister packs or inserts. These packaging solutions help protect pills and capsules from environmental factors, such as humidity and light, which can degrade their efficacy. Pe Foam can also be engineered to provide a tamper &#8211; evident feature, adding an extra layer of security for patients and healthcare providers.<\/p>\n<h3>Cosmetics and Beauty Products<\/h3>\n<p>The cosmetics and beauty industry places a strong emphasis on product presentation and protection. Pe Foam is a popular choice for thermo &#8211; formed packaging in this sector.<\/p>\n<p>Lipsticks, eyeshadows, and perfumes are often packaged in aesthetically pleasing thermo &#8211; formed Pe Foam trays. The foam can be molded into unique shapes and designs to enhance the product&#8217;s visual appeal on the retail shelf. At the same time, it provides a secure and protective environment for the delicate cosmetics.<\/p>\n<p>The water &#8211; resistant and chemical &#8211; resistant properties of Pe Foam are also beneficial in this application. They protect the products from spills, leaks, and chemical reactions, ensuring that they reach the consumer in perfect condition.<\/p>\n<h3>Automotive Parts Packaging<\/h3>\n<p>The automotive industry deals with a wide range of parts, from small, delicate sensors to large, heavy engine components. Pe Foam is used extensively in thermo &#8211; formed packaging for automotive parts due to its excellent cushioning and shock &#8211; absorbing capabilities.<\/p>\n<p>Thermo &#8211; formed Pe Foam inserts can be customized to fit the complex shapes of automotive parts. They protect the parts from scratches, dents, and other forms of damage during shipping and storage. For example, a high &#8211; performance engine block may require a custom &#8211; molded Pe Foam tray to prevent any movement that could cause internal damage.<\/p>\n<p>The durability of Pe Foam is also an advantage in automotive parts packaging. It can withstand the rigors of long &#8211; distance transportation and multiple handling operations without losing its protective properties.<\/p>\n<h3>Customization and Design Flexibility<\/h3>\n<p>One of the key benefits of using Pe Foam in thermo &#8211; formed packaging is its high degree of customization and design flexibility. Pe Foam offers several environmental advantages in the context of thermo &#8211; formed packaging.<\/p>\n<p>Many Pe Foams are recyclable, which means they can be reused to create new products at the end of their life cycle. This reduces the amount of waste sent to landfills and contributes to a more circular economy. Additionally, the lightweight nature of Pe Foam helps reduce the carbon footprint associated with transportation, as less energy is required to move lighter packages.<\/p>\n<p>Some manufacturers are also exploring the use of bio &#8211; based Pe Foams, which are made from renewable resources. These bio &#8211; based alternatives offer similar properties to traditional Pe Foam but have a lower environmental impact.<\/p>\n<h3>Conclusion<\/h3>\n<p>As a Pe Foam supplier, I am constantly fascinated by the endless possibilities of using this material in thermo &#8211; formed packaging.
